Check out http://www.leatherique.com
Their products are truly amazing. They have some how-to articles and photos up and if you're a PCA member, there is a discount.
Basically, the rejuvinating oil works its way into the leather and forces all of the dirt, gunk, and general schmutz out onto the top. The oil also restores the leather to its former glove-like state of suppleness.
Then you use their Prestine Clean product to get all the crap off of the seat.
